Polish troops fought for Haiti's independence and none of the Haitians I've talked to knew this
I'm Polish and I've been living in the Dominican Republic for 3 years now. A while back I learned that Napoleon sent Polish troops to Saint-Domingue to help crush the Haitian Revolution — but many of them ended up switching sides and fighting alongside the Haitians instead.
Some of their descendants reportedly still live in Haiti today, in a village called Cazale, where locals are known to have lighter skin and blue or green eyes because of that history.
I mentioned this to a few Haitian people I've met here in the DR, and none of them had heard about it before. It made me really curious how well-known this part of history actually is among Haitians themselves versus how it's remembered (or not) elsewhere.

Les Chasseurs-Volontaires de Saint-Domingue
500 Soldiers with Haitian Ancestry that were free or either Mulatto from St. Domingue joined French Forces to help America fight against the British for their independence. Although they were under the French banner because Haiti was not established until 1804, they were undeniably Haitian and they are our Haitian ancestors.
